Christoph Daferner Returns to Dynamo Dresden: A Key Player for the Black and Yellows

Dresden – Return to his old stomping ground! Christoph Daferner (26) will play for Dynamo Dresden again. The Black and Yellows announced this on Friday afternoon.

According to the report, the 26-year-old will be joining on loan for the next season from second division club 1. FC Nuremberg – and will be hunting for goals for the team of new head coach Thomas Stamm (41).

The attacker is no stranger to the Black and Yellows: Between 2020 and 2022, the Swabian native played for the third division club, making 75 competitive appearances. The 1.89 meter tall attacker scored 27 goals and provided nine assists.

In the 2020/2021 season, Daferner contributed to the team’s promotion to the 2nd Bundesliga with his skills and goal-scoring ability, scoring twelve times and setting up seven goals.

The following year he again proved his ability to score goals, but his goals were not enough to prevent the team from being relegated to the third division. He then moved to the Franconians in Nuremberg. Now he is making his comeback at the Rudolf Harbig Stadium!

“We are very pleased that we have been able to strengthen our team qualitatively with Christoph Daferner and thus significantly increase the competitive situation in the offensive area,” explains SGD Managing Director Thomas Brendel (48).

Dynamo’s new coach knows the strengths of the new signing: “He can certainly help us and the whole team with his quality and experience from the second and third leagues and, on a human level, with his down-to-earth nature and absolute will to work hard, he fits in very well with the group,” Stamm praises the striker, with whom he already worked in Freiburg.

“The way he plays football corresponds exactly to what we imagine the club’s playing philosophy should be.”
